The Calling

I know you’re there Somewhere, around me Part of the shadows Covered by the force of habit
You winked at me when I was young In my dreams From under my bed You teased me with fear
Now it’s only a whisper But it’s there A stir in my slumbering A sandgrain in my system
When I lie in bed at night You mumble Sultry chill Through every hole and corner
When I’m kissed by the sun Your shadow Tickles me And sends a shiver down my spine
In Amsterdam Where everyone walks their way You’re the one That watches me
So stealthy But I can see you drawing near With the growing shadows at sunset Behind the window
So sneaky But I can hear you approaching Through the ticking of the clock Above my easy chair
As wisdom sprouts To full growth And serenity Settles down Your voice becomes clearer Almost intelligible
As your caresses Begin to unroot me And your breath Starts to crumple my leaves You start to sing Ever so softly
My whole life Drenched with colors Under a firmament of grey Is displayed on flowered wallpaper
In my darkest hour I reach out As your rejoicing chime Calls me home
